Randstad Talent Advisory - Consultant
Randstad Enterprise is a global talent leader, providing solutions and expertise that help companies position for growth, execute on strategy, and improve business agility.
Through Randstad Talent Advisory, we deliver forward-thinking workforce strategies, combining research, technology, and human ingenuity to help organizations solve complex talent challenges.
Job Purpose / Role Impact
To execute high-quality data analysis, research, and collateral creation using advanced technology and your own AI curiosity, converting raw information into solid foundation blocks for client delivery while learning the advisory craft on the job.
As a Consultant, you are the baseline execution engine of our project delivery.
Bringing your curiosity, problem solving skills, and drive for excellence to our team, you offer fresh insight, analytical capability, and a deep interest in people and the evolving nature of work.
Your focus is a generalist one, working across all product areas, including Work Design, Assessment, EVP, Emerging Talent, Operating Models, and Work Planning, but you do not require prior experience or knowledge and will learn our methodologies from the ground up.
This role is ideal for graduates or someone looking for a fresh start in a new career - who has a particular interest in consultancy and shaping future workforces.
The Talent Advisory team will help you learn effectively, without feeling overwhelmed.
Defining your focus areas, where you collaborate, and the boundaries of your role.
What You Will Do: Key Responsibilities & Rhythm of the Role
Your time and energy will be balanced across three core areas
- 1. Delivery Engine (75% of your role)
- Tech-Driven Data & Analytics: Run complex talent analysis efficiently, actively adopting AI models and automation tools to shorten time-to-insight.
- Collateral & Content
Production: Draft baseline communications, report content, presentation decks, insight reports, and client workshop packs that are simple, clear, and error-free.
- Research Mastery: Gather market trends, talent intelligence, and industry benchmarks, synthesising findings into actionable client summaries.
- 2. Product Development (10% of your role)
- Support the execution and testing of standard product frameworks.
- Assist in building collateral to showcase and explain our core advisory solutions.
- Identify opportunities for continual improvement.
- 3. Learning & Administration (15% of your role)
- Upskill on advisory methodologies
- Keep pace with emerging AI and talent trends.
- Participate in internal team workshops Manage standard admin (timesheets, project documentation, and logistics).

Final notes
This role is part of a structured development programme.
We do not expect applicants to bring subject matter expertise or pre-existing AI fluency.
We are looking for people with a genuine interest in the areas we consult in, a drive to deliver excellence for our clients, a deep curiosity and openness to progressive technology, and a commitment to continual professional growth.
New joiners will be part of a small cohort (2-4 people) and will be given a week-long induction, a structured learning programme which covers consulting skills, subject matter expertise, and the application of AI and Automation to people and talent projects.
Each Consultant will also be given individual and group coaching and will have a dedicated mentor.
